CVE-2025-13189
A vulnerability has been found in D-Link DIR-816L 206b09beta. This affects the function genacgimain of the file gena.cgi. The manipulation of the argument SERVERID/HTTPSID leads to stack-based buffer overflow. The attack is possible to be carried out remotely. The exploit has been disclosed to th...
